    Lyme radiculopathy is usually worse at night and accompanied by extreme sleep disturbance, lymphocytic meningitis with variable headache and no fever, and sometimes by facial palsy or Lyme carditis. [12] Lyme can also cause a milder, chronic radiculopathy an average of 8 months after the acute illness. [3]

    [4] [9] Sciatica is most common between the ages of 40 and 59, and men are more frequently affected than women. [2] [3] The condition has been known since ancient times. [3] The first known modern use of the word sciatica dates from 1451, [10] although Dioscorides (1st-century CE) mentions it in his Materia Medica. [11]

    Patients also display involuntary limb movements that occur at periodic intervals anywhere from 20 to 40 seconds apart. They often only last the first half of the night during non-REM sleep stages. Movements do not occur during REM because of muscle atonia. PLMS can be unilateral or bilateral and not really symmetrical or simultaneous. [6]
